Platform Seoul 2008, promotional materials

Newsletter: front page

Promotional materials for the exhibition at various venues in Seoul, 2008. Newsletter, 255 x 360 mm, 4 pp; invitation, 210 x 150 mm; leaflet, accordion-folded, 128 x 180 mm, 8 pp; magazine advertisement, various dimensions; on-site banners, various dimensions. The large-scale exhibition, organized by Samuso, was held at various galleries in Seoul simultaneously. We designed the logo to suggest the sense of wandering around the city, by using the graphic language of street sign with confusingly placed arrow marks. The subtitle of the exhibition, focused on non-visual experiences of art, was ‘I have nothing to say and I am saying it’: a quotation from John Cage’s famous lecture on nothing. We scanned a page of Cage’s book Silence (1961) where the quote was originally published, underlined the sentence to highlight it, and then used the image throughout.
